SASS SLP Clinic

 

The School of Audiology and Speech Sciences is excited to announce a student-led SASS Clinic!

Note: Due to the positive support we have received, the SASS Speech & Language Clinic is now running at full capacity for the Fall 2021 pilot project.

Designed as a pilot project, the SASS Clinic is partnering with the current student-led Physical Therapy & Research Clinic (PTRC) in the Friedman building (https://physioclinic.med.ubc.ca/).

With support from the Faculty of Medicine for its development, the SASS Clinic’s purpose is to increase internal clinical learning and placement opportunities within our School.

The project will focus on providing assessment and intervention to adult clients with neurogenic communication disorders (e.g., Aphasia, Apraxia of Speech, Dysarthria and Cognitive-Communication needs), as a result of a stroke, Traumatic Brain Injury, Parkinson’s disease, or dementia; using principles of the World Health Organization’s International Classification of Functioning (ICF) and Evidence-Based Practice (EBP).

The clinic will be open two days a week, Mondays and Thursdays, starting September 27 to December 9, 2021.

All appointments will include or be run by one of two SLP graduate students during their 3rd clinical externship, under the supervision of two licensed Speech-Language Pathologists.

There will be opportunities for interdisciplinary learning, joint sessions, and possible group sessions with the SLP students at the SASS Clinic and the Physical Therapy students at the PTRC.
